Total number of vehicles in the institution’s fleet:
Number of vehicles in the institution's fleet that are:
Number of Vehicles | |
Gasoline-only | 103 |
Diesel-only | 9 |
Gasoline-electric hybrid | 4 |
Diesel-electric hybrid | 0 |
Plug-in hybrid | 0 |
100 percent electric | 7 |
Fueled with Compressed Natural Gas (CNG) | 0 |
Hydrogen fueled | 0 |
Fueled with B20 or higher biofuel | 0 |
Fueled with locally produced, low-level biofuel | 0 |

Campus fleet sustainable transportation breakdown:
3 hybrid electric vehicles with the police
1 all electric vehicle with LUPD (awaiting three more)
2 all electric vehicles with facilities services
1 all electric vehicle with transportation services
1 all electric bus
2 all electric utility carts with athletics
The campus fleet was not impacted by COVID-19 and therefore is representative of a normal year.
